Recall Insight

This FDA Food action (record #F-1418-2019) was formally reported on June 5, 2019, with the manufacturer initiating the action on April 29, 2019. It is classified under Moderate severity (Class II), with a current status of Terminated. Fiddyment Farms INC is listed as the recalling firm, operating out of Lincoln, CA. Federal records list the affected scope as 11,681 lbs..

The documented reason for this recall is: Undeclared hydrolyzed soy protein. Distribution data in the federal record shows the product reached: U.S. distribution to the following: CA, PA, AR, LA, MT, IL. NV, NM.
